83-year-old with dementia still missing; truck found in Mount Baker-Snoqualmie National Forest

The Snohomish County Sheriff's Office is still looking for an 83-year-old man who was reported missing nearly two weeks ago. 

Deputies say Rodrick Latham left his home in Snohomish sometime overnight on Feb. 10 in a 2005 black GMC Sierra truck.

Latham has dementia and does not normally drive, according to deputies.

He was last seen wearing light-colored khaki-style pants, a gray wool jacket and a baseball hat. 

His truck was found near Rat Trap Pass in the Mount Baker-Snoqualmie National Forest. 

"More than 45 ground searchers, helicopter, drones, dogs, man trackers, etc. conducted a search all week last week. Sadly, he has not been located," said Courtney O'Keefe, Director of Communications for the Snohomish County Sheriff's Office.
